Fig. 7: Reduced autophagic activity causes delayed petal abscission.

From: Petal abscission is promoted by jasmonic acid-induced autophagy at Arabidopsis petal bases

Fig. 7

a ATG gene expression in WT, snac and dad1 petals from position +3 flowers (n = 3 independent experiments). The heatmap shows the Log10(ppm) genes based on transcriptome data in the mutants relative to the WT. The boxplots above the heatmap show the distribution of expression changes relative to the WT. Boxes encompass the inter-quartiles (25th–75th percentiles), horizontal lines are means, and range bars show the maximum and minimum values excluding outliers. Asterisks indicate statistically significant differences between the WT and mutants based on FDR. The colored bars to the right of the heatmap show expression levels in the WT. b IGV browser view of ANAC102 ChIP and input signals at ATG8a, ATG9, ATG8i, ATG18h, ATG8g and ATG1b loci. Purple horizontal bars indicate a statistically significant difference between ChIP and input signals. The gene models are shown as black bars (coding regions) and lines (non-coding regions) at the bottom of each panel. c Heatmap showing the absolute expression values of eight ATG genes based on public transcriptome data. d GUS reporter staining pattern for the ATG8a promoter in WT (left) or snac mutant (right) during petal abscission. Scale bar = 1 mm. e Zoomed-in views of GUS staining for the ATG8a promoter in the WT (top) and the snac mutant (bottom) during petal abscission. Scale bar = 100 µm. f Side view of WT and atg8a-1 inflorescences. Open flowers with petals are indicated by asterisks. Scale bar = 1 cm. g Quantification of the timing of abscission, shown as individual data points (left) and violin plots (right) for each genotype. Black dots and vertical lines indicate mean and SD, respectively. n = 10. One-tailed Student’s t test, *p = 0.01. h DAB staining of WT and atg8a-1 petals from position +3 flowers. Scale bars = 100 µm. i Trypan blue staining of WT and atg8a-1 petals of position +3 flowers. Scale bar = 100 µm.
